Orange-tailed insect with orange-tipped antennas (2) and a black body. ID Please! (North-Texas)

This was the strangest insect I've seen in awhile.
Saw this forum online, so I felt like it was necessary to post it here. I see 0 documentation of it elsewhere upon googling the image and definitions of the insect.

The tail on this insect is orange, its pitched upwards, and has black speckles on it.
The insect itself is mainly black, it has 6 legs, and 2 antennas.
It moves rather slowly using all six legs, it cannot fly (as far as I observed), and it uses its antennas to detect what's around it; so I assume it has bad eyesight. The antennas have orange-tips at the end, too.

Someone posted the same or similar insect recently and it was identified as a nymph of an assassin bug, likely Arilus cristatus, a wheel bug. http://bugguide.net/node/view/118336 These are predator bugs and are good to have around.
